So, '8 Assassins' is kind of an interesting watch. The pacing feels a bit uneven at times, but it really captures that gritty desert vibe. The outlaws, especially the lead, have this rawness to their performances that gives it a grounded feel, if you know what I mean. The themes of heroism and redemption are woven through, especially when our thief meets the tribal chief. Their dynamic kind of drives the film forward. The practical effects are decent, adding that old-school charm that some newer films lack. Not a heavyweight by any means, but there's something about its rough edges that makes it stand out.
